我们经常在做爬行动物的过程中遇到这种情况。初始爬虫正常运行,通常捕获数据正常,但过不了多久就出问题了,比如403 Forbidden。
当您打开网页时,您可能会看到类似“您的 IP 访问频率过高”的提示。造成这种现象的原因是该网站采取了一些反爬行动措施。
例如,服务器将以单位时间检测IP请求的数量。如果超过此阈值,它将直接拒绝服务并返回一些错误信息。这种情况可以称为封IP。
由于服务器检测到IP单元时间的请求数,然后以某种方式伪装我们的IP,使服务器无法识别本地机器发起的请求,我们能成功阻止IP被封吗?
一种有效的方法是使用Cloud Cube ADSL 动态IP 拨号 VPS 。 目前,爬虫代理服务提供商将详细说明ADSL动态IP拨号VPS的使用。
在此之前,您需要了解ADSL动态IP拨号VPS的基本原理。
ADSL动态IP拨号VPS的基本原理
它是如何实现IP伪装的?ADSL动态IP拨号VPS的基本原理ADSL动态IP拨号VPS实际上是指拨号服务器,其功能是代理网络用户获取网络信息。
在图像中,它是网络信息的中转点。当我们正常请求网站时,我们向Web服务器发送请求,Web服务器将响应发送回给我们。
如果设置了 代理服务器 ,它实际上是本地计算机和服务器之间的桥接器。此时,本地设备不直接向Web服务器发出请求,而是向代理服务器发送请求,请求被发送到代理服务器,然后代理服务器将其发送到Web服务器,然后代理服务器将Web服务器返回的响应转发给本地计算机。通过这种方式,我们也可以正常访问网页,但在此过程中,Web服务器识别的 真实IP 不再是本地机器的IP,并且IP伪装成功实现。这就是动态IP拨号VPS的基本原理。
1337
166
上一篇:细数香港vps主机四大好处